About 220 Swanson Dr W Unit 1

Awesome one owner home with finished basement. This spacious home is located in one of Athens GA most desirable neighborhoods. Swanson Estate is located on Timothy Road in Athens GA, This home has great potential good bones just in need of a little TLC and updating.This home is located in the Timothy Road Elemenary School and the newly renovated Clarke Middle school District. Facts about the home: total heated space 3207 sq ft.,total number of bedrooms including the basement 6,owner'suite,two closets providing for extra storage,just off of the den is the sun room which overlooks a beautiful back yard,finished basement with bedroons, a bathroom ,study or sitting room and storage.The basement leads out to an enormous back yard. The back yard consist of a very large built in grill and a large brick storage building. This four sided brick home has a two car garage.This well built home is just waiting for a new owner to come and give it a little TLC.

Living in Athens, GA

Athens has a well-developed transport infrastructure, with a network of roads and highways that connect the city to the wider region. Public transportation is available, with bus services providing connectivity across various neighborhoods. The city is also bike-friendly, with dedicated lanes and trails for cyclists, and walkable areas, particularly in the downtown district, encourage pedestrian movement. Ride-sharing services are operational, complementing the existing transport options.

The community is served by a robust educational system, including a number of public and private schools, as well as higher education institutions known for their research and academic excellence.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with several hospitals and clinics catering to a range of medical needs. Athens also features a variety of retail and dining options, from local boutiques to international cuisine, reflecting the eclectic nature of the city.

Athens is celebrated for its vibrant music scene and the annual AthFest Music and Arts Festival, which showcases local talent and fosters community spirit. The city prides itself on its blend of southern charm and progressive culture, offering residents a unique living experience that combines a rich historical ambiance with a dynamic, creative energy.

Athens offers a diverse array of housing options, with single-family homes being a significant part of the market. The architectural styles in Athens range from historic antebellum to contemporary, reflecting the city's rich history and modern growth. While the majority of homes are owner-occupied, there is also a substantial portion of the population that rents, providing a balanced housing market for both potential homeowners and renters.

Over 22 listings were sold over their listed price in June 2025 in Athens, GA. In the same period over 111 listings were sold below the listed price and 51 listings were sold for the listed price. Between May and June 2025, Athens, GA real estate market has seen decrease in the number of listings by 0.9%. The median list price of listings available in June 2025 was $350,000, while the average time on the real estate market was 41 days.
